Tip: replacing the battle music

Post by shellshock »

I found the in battle music too strident, especially after a few times. So I renamed the data\music\InBattle.mp3 file, and made a copy of the FrontEnd.mp3 file, and called the copy InBattle.mp3. Now I have the soothing tones of the front end music when I'm in battle. I find it much more atmospheric.
